Â I realise this was a PCC joke, but i'll quickly praise this cinema. Â I'm going there this evening to see Amadeus. Cracking place, regularly showing musicals/cult films specifically for audience participation. I saw The Room there last week, which was great (I had my plastic spoons ready to throw) and they did a 'Schwing Along to Waynes World' last week as well. Â Generally there isn't that many chav scum, more arty types/students.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
